We found 4 dictionaries that define the word to clap the hands:
General (4 matching dictionaries)
General (4 matching dictionaries)
- to clap the hands: Wordnik
- To clap the hands: Dictionary.com
- to clap the hands: FreeDictionary.org
- To clap the hands: TheFreeDictionary.com